Calories in Kellogg's Special K Cereal Bars Dark Chocolate Pomegranate .88oz

📏 Serving Size: 1 Bar (25.0g)

🧪 Nutrition Facts

Amount Per Serving
  • Calories 97.0
  • Total Fat 1.8 g
  • Saturated Fat 0.9 g
  • Cholesterol 0.0 mg
  • Sodium 40.8 mg
  • Potassium 37.5 mg
  • Total Carbohydrate 19.6 g
  • Dietary Fiber 0.9 g
  • Sugars 7.7 g
  • Protein 1.3 g

📝 Ingredients

Rolled Oats, Rice Flour, Corn Syrup, Pomegranate Flavored Cranberries (cranberries, Sugar, Natural Flavor), Fructose, Semisweet Chocolate Chips (dried Cane Syrup, Chocolate, Cocoa Butter, Soy Lecithin, Vanilla Beans), Sugar, Palm Oil, Contains 2% or Less of Dried Pomegranate Arils, Dextrose, Glycerin, Sorbitol, Salt, Natural Flavors, Molasses, Malt Extract, Soy Lecithin, Mixed Tocopherols for Freshness, Rosemary Extract for Freshness, Citric Acid, Lemon Juice Concentrate, Pear Juice Concentrate, Plum Juice Concentrate, Pineapple Syrup, Pomegranate Juice Concentrate, Nonfat Milk, Wheat Starch, Elderberry Juice Concentrate.
